Whales over Wales

In 1971 a new film version of ‘Under Milk Wood’ was made in Wales using an area of Fishguard as Llareggub. In an interview made at the time, Richard Burton (‘First Voice’ in this production) discusses Dylan Thomas’ use of visuals as shown in “Under Milk Wood” in particular. He describes seeing a Dylan Thomas painting in New York, called, in typical Dylan style, ‘Whales over Wales’. Burton is interviewed by Ronnie Williams for a Late Call Special.
